Transaction 5929e808b8a2e8cd821f158df3aab263fa1d6e623e13f95f59fc04e91c49f5a2

1 Input
2 Outputs
  • 5929e808b8a2e8cd821f158df3aab263fa1d6e623e13f95f59fc04e91c49f5a2:0
  • value  1540287
    address  33ff6f1uRQRgebAVTqntfxwohtvPw8P7sv
  • 5929e808b8a2e8cd821f158df3aab263fa1d6e623e13f95f59fc04e91c49f5a2:1
  • value  66620421
    address  3GYP2LRoNaP8GEGLh5Fejn474BPoPtxEgF